Innolux G104X1-L03: 10.4" XGA LCD for Extreme Temperatures

Innolux G104X1-L03: Resilient 10.4" XGA Display for Harsh Environments

As industrial automation expands into uncontrolled environments, the Innolux G104X1-L03 10.4” XGA Color TFT-LCD Module provides unwavering visual clarity and operational stability. It delivers robust performance for demanding industrial and outdoor applications where temperature and vibration are critical operational factors. With key specifications of 1024x768 XGA | -30°C to +80°C Operating Temperature | 50,000hr LED Backlight, this display is engineered to reduce system thermal management complexity and ensure long-term field reliability. It directly answers the need for HMI panels in unconditioned environments by guaranteeing startup and performance from -30°C, a frequent point of failure for lesser-rated screens.

Inside the G104X1-L03: The Engineering of Resilience

The datasheet values of the G104X1-L03 translate directly to tangible engineering benefits centered on durability and consistent performance. What is the key benefit of the G104X1-L03's wide temperature range? It enables direct deployment in unconditioned environments without auxiliary heating or cooling. This operational flexibility acts like an all-season tire for your system; it's engineered to maintain performance integrity whether facing the freezing cold of a winter loading dock or the radiant heat inside a sun-exposed vehicle cabin. [4] This capability is fundamental to its design.

Further enhancing its resilience is the anti-glare surface treatment. How does the anti-glare surface improve usability? It diffuses incident ambient light, ensuring high readability and reducing operator eye strain in challenging lighting conditions. [3] This is critical for maintaining safety and accuracy in industrial workplaces. Complementing this is the WLED backlight system, rated for a typical lifetime of 50,000 hours. This figure, equivalent to over 5.7 years of continuous 24/7 operation, signifies a drastic reduction in maintenance cycles and total cost of ownership over the product's lifespan.

Core Specifications for System Integration

The following parameters are essential for system design and integration. For complete details, please refer to the official datasheet.

Specification Value
Screen Size 10.4 inch
Resolution 1024(RGB)×768, XGA [3]
Operating Temperature -30°C to 80°C
Brightness 350 cd/m² (Typ.) [2]
Interface LVDS (1 ch, 6/8-bit), 30 pins [2]
Backlight Lifetime 50,000 Hours (Typ.)
